(KTNC--) Two Rock Port residents suffered moderate injuries in a single vehicle wreck on Route B, 6 miles east of Watson early Friday evening.
According the the Missouri Highway Patrol, a vehicle driven by 49-year-old Julie Fentiman was westbound on Route B when the vehicle traveled off the north side of the road, returned to the roadway, crossed the center line and struck the bridge on the south side of the roadway.
Fentinman and her passenger, 49-year-old Steven Caudil, were transported to Grape Community Hospital in Hamburg. Iowa by the Atchsison Holt Ambulance.
The Atchison Sheriff's Office, the Watson Fire Department and the Rock Port Fire Department assisted at the scene.
